Cognism is the leading provider of European B2B data and sales intelligence. Ambitious businesses of every size use our platform to discover, connect, and engage with qualified decision-makers faster and close more deals. Headquartered in London with global offices, Cognism's contact data and contextual signals are trusted by thousands of revenue teams to eliminate the guesswork from prospecting.

Remote or Hybrid: This can be a remote or hybrid role depending on your location and proximity to one of our local offices.

As a Data Scientist III (Information Retrieval), you will design and implement advanced models, drive innovation through machine learning and AI, and mentor team members. In this high-impact role, your work will directly shape Cognism's data-driven products and business strategies.

Your Challenges & Opportunities

  • Develop Advanced Models – Build and maintain sophisticated statistical and machine learning models that drive business decisions and integrate with enterprise systems.
  • Lead Innovation – Design and pilot cutting-edge predictive models and algorithms, testing scalability and implementing successful approaches into production environments.
  • Own Projects End-to-End – Scope, design, implement, and evaluate data science solutions independently, while keeping stakeholders aligned on progress and results.
  • Drive Business Value –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ify opportunities where data science can make a measurable impact on customer experience or operational efficiency.
  • Mentor Team Members – Support and guide junior data scientists by sharing best practices, providing feedback, and contributing to an inclusive, knowledge-sharing culture.
  • Shape Data Strategy – Work closely with the Data Science Manager to prioritize projects and align outputs with strategic goals.

Our Expectations

  • Professional Experience – 3+ years in a data science role, with a strong track record of delivering impactful, production-ready solutions on Information Retrieval systems (e.g., recommender systems, search engines, vector-based search).
  • Technical Expertise – Proficient in Python, Spark, and machine learning frameworks; strong understanding of statistical modeling and big data processing.
  • Cloud Proficiency – Experience with AWS tools such as S3, SageMaker Studio, Glue Jobs, and Athena is highly desirable.
  • Educational Background – PhD preferred in Data Science, NLP, Information Retrieval, Mathematics, or Statistics. A Master's degree with significant experience will also be considered.
  • Problem-Solving Ability – Strong analytical mindset with the ability to design practical, scalable solutions to complex problems.
  • Communication Skills – Comfortable explaining techn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ders and influencing decisions through data insights.
  • Collaborative Approach – Proven ability to work effectively in cross-functional teams and agile environments.

Our Tech Stack

  • Python & PySpark – Build, test, and deploy machine learning pipelines using scalable data processing tools.
  • AWS Ecosystem – Leverage services like SageMaker, S3, Glue, and Athena for data engineering and ML model deployment.
  • ML Frameworks – Work with tools such as scikit-learn, TensorFlow, or similar libraries to experiment and optimize models.
  • Version Control – Use Git and CI/CD tools to manage code and streamline development workflows.
  • Data Visualization – Communicate findings with clarity using tools like matplotlib, seaborn, or business-friendly dashboards.
  • SQL & Big Data – Write efficient queries to extract insights from large, complex data sets.
